ここから本文です

あるエクセルファイルを開いたときに 誰が開いても同じフォント、背景色、線色な...

ger********さん

2012/6/1310:00:44

あるエクセルファイルを開いたときに
誰が開いても同じフォント、背景色、線色など
自動で設定できる方法ありませんか?

VBA(マクロ)でオブジェクトの既定値の設定を利用すればできそうなのですが。
参考になるサイトでもあればお願いします。

補足aabpaojapさん
回答ありがとうございます。
すみません、言葉足らずでした…。
セルの書式ではなくオートシェイプの書式を強制的に設定したいのです。
わざわざコーディングまで教えていただいておいて申し訳ありません。
ですがWorkbook_Open()を使うところは非常に参考になりました。

閲覧数:
1,627
回答数:
1
お礼:
100枚

違反報告

ベストアンサーに選ばれた回答

aab********さん

2012/6/1515:54:58

お疲れ様です。
希望する任意のThisWorkbookに記述させる構文です。
開いた時に必ず実行できます。
試して下さい。


Option Explicit

Private Sub Workbook_Open()

On Error Resume Next '※ エラー回避
Application.ScreenUpdating = False '● 画面を固定する
Application.WindowState = xlMaximized '※ 画面最大化


'----以下は希望する対象の操作ですので 御自分で手直しお願いします
'-----------------------------------------------------------------

With Cells
.Interior.ColorIndex = xlNone
.HorizontalAlignment = xlRight
.VerticalAlignment = xlCenter
.Font.Name = "MS Pゴシック"
.Font.Size = 12
.Font.ColorIndex = 1



End With

'-----------------------------------------------------------------

Range("DK10000").Select
ActiveWindow.ScrollRow = 1
ActiveWindow.ScrollColumn = 1
End Sub

質問した人からのコメント

2012/6/20 09:06:07

降参 ありがとうございました。
参考にさせていただきます。

みんなで作る知恵袋 悩みや疑問、なんでも気軽にきいちゃおう!

Q&Aをキーワードで検索:

Yahoo! JAPANは、回答に記載された内容の信ぴょう性、正確性を保証しておりません。
お客様自身の責任と判断で、ご利用ください。
本文はここまでです このページの先頭へ

「追加する」ボタンを押してください。

閉じる

※知恵コレクションに追加された質問は選択されたID/ニックネームのMy知恵袋で確認できます。

不適切な投稿でないことを報告しました。

閉じる